In The Black Out - Jibanananda Das

Once to the stars - once to the fields I cast my winkless eyes. The scent of paddy disappeared from life when who knows; Like the meadows laden with haystacks here and there Quietly; he feels dozy. "What will happen if the stars glow - glow - glow and dim - and then dim forever? " Cautioned, he wakes up again. With straw scattered all over it feels sleepy, Sleep engulfs. The evening sky is studded with stars - this sky of night; Here in the Falgoon shadow I sprawl on the turf of grass; A gift of death right here, and these grasses will cling onto my body; A galaxy of stars will forever remain close by. Who sneezed there? - must be Hamid's one-eyed moribund horse! Enough he has worked, all day pulling the cart Now in the moonlight he is bent upon eating grass - no more tasks.
